Can be trimmed to keep at 6m if required. 16''/40cm pot | Patio type tomato varieties are perfect not only for fitting limited space but also for ease of access and care, especially when grown in containers. Their compact vines produce a full-size abundance of fruit. Keep a mix of them close at hand for quick tending and a deliciously varied harvest. Can be eaten fresh off the vine or used in salads and cooking. Excellent for flavoring a variety of dishes. Preserve by canning, drying, or freezing. The plant grows to about 1m tall and requires staking for the best production. Plants are spaced 50cm each and grown in full sun. They prefer moist and well-drained soil enriched with some compost and fertilizer. 4''/10cm pot | |||||
